Job Description

The Distribution Design Engineer I plans, engineers, and designs electric and gas distribution systems that support safe, reliable, and efficient power delivery.

This entry-level role focuses on developing work packages, performing basic engineering and design calculations, and supporting field activities to ensure that distribution infrastructure meets economic, environmental, social, regulatory, and reliability requirements.

The position works under supervision on less complex assignments and contributes to the development of solutions using established principles and procedures.

Responsibilities

  • Plan and design electric and gas distribution systems in alignment with established engineering standards, procedures, and regulatory requirements.
  • Determine the need, size, location, and timing of power delivery infrastructure to balance economic, environmental, social, and regulatory constraints with reliability needs.
  • Develop work packages for overhead and underground residential distribution projects, including required documentation and technical details.
  • Support the engineering and design of underground cable and conduit systems for power distribution.
  • Perform basic field engineering activities, including visiting sites in the assigned area to collect pictures, measurements, and other data related to existing power distribution assets.
  • Identify and document conflicting utilities or site conditions that may affect design or construction activities.
  • Conduct routine engineering and design calculations using established methods and tools to support project requirements.
  • Assist with post-construction reviews to verify that completed work aligns with design specifications and standards.
  • Follow established procedures and policies to solve simple, routine technical problems within the distribution design scope.
  • Collaborate and communicate with peers to explain facts, basic analyses, processes, and practices related to distribution design projects.
  • Maintain accurate records of design work, field data, and project documentation in accordance with company standards.

Work Environment

This role follows a hybrid work model, with approximately 80% of the time spent working from home and 20% in the field within the area being supported.

Remote work typically involves performing design engineering tasks, preparing work packages, conducting calculations, and collaborating with team members using standard office and engineering software tools.

Field work involves visiting distribution sites to collect photographs, measurements, and other data on existing power distribution infrastructure, which may require walking over varied terrain and working in outdoor conditions.

The position operates within a structured environment that emphasizes adherence to established procedures, safety practices, and quality standards, while providing guidance and supervision appropriate for an entry-level engineer.
